UK: Indian-origin man charged with murder
London, Apr 12: An Indian-orign man has been accussed of murdering a man, whose body was in an industrial estate in London with stab wounds, Scotland Yard said.
43-year-old Balraj Singh has been charged with murder and he will be appearing before the Ealing Magistrates' Court, west London, on Monday, Apr 12.
The officers were informed about the murder after the body of the victim with a stab wound on the chest was found at business unit in the Bridge Road Industrial Estate, Southall, Middlesex.
Parademics and air ambulance were rushed to the spot but the victim was declared dead at the scene of crime.
Police said that the relatives of the deceased have been informed about the incident, adding that his identity is yet to be formally ascertained.
The post mortem report determined the cause of death as the single stab wound on the chest.
